in my opinion the original mix is almost flawless. love the acid sounds in the track. everything meshes together really well. the opening bell sounds extremely similar to the one used in Aria - Dido (AvB remix)
the Vorontsov & Dorohov Remix is alright. sounds sort of housier and more dance-floor oriented but still doesnt compare to the original. i hope they dont release a bunch of remixes butchering this beauty
Original 9/10
Vorontsov & Dorohov Remix 4/10
